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Access
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 30.05.2016, 15:54   #1
tolikman
Форумчанин
 
Регистрация: 25.08.2008
Сообщений: 159
Вопрос "Подтаблица" в запросе

Добрый день!

Хочу упростить себе немного работу с данными.

В таблицах Access есть функция "Подтаблица" и связывание полей,
это когда можно взять одну таблицу, нажать на плюсик и развернуть подтаблицу.

Все отлично работает с таблицами: если поля таблицы и подтаблицы связаны то можно добавлять новые записи не беспокоясь о целостности данных, в подтаблице автоматом проставляется ссылка на родительский элемент.

Однако в запросах у меня такая же система не получается.

Есть два запроса, родительский и дочерний.
На схеме и в свойствах самого запроса связь я указал.
Таблица разворачивается, но когда я добавляю новую строку, то я должен указать ссылку на родительский элемент сам, автоматом она не проставляется...

Кто-нибудь сталкивался с таким вопросом, такое возможно в запросах?
Не хочу городить формы, табличного интерфейса акса должно хватить.
tolikman вне форума Ответить с цитированием
Старый 03.06.2016, 20:47   #2
VinniPuh
Пользователь
 
Аватар для VinniPuh
 
Регистрация: 03.02.2016
Сообщений: 49
По умолчанию

Нужно всегда работать только с ФОРМАМИ, а не с таблицами или запросами.
В таблицах должны храниться только данные
В запросах происходить вычисления, отбор нужного или сортировка
В отчетах - Просмотр и распечатка.
Это основополагающиеся истины, т. к. это именно так и задумано разработчиками.
VinniPuh в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Для заданной строки определить все входящие в неё символ. Например: строка "abccbbabbac" состоит из символов "a", "b" и "c" Sandakan01 Помощь студентам 1 24.02.2016 03:20